Understanding Leprosy What is Leprosy? Leprosy, also known as Hansen’s disease, is a chronic infectious disease caused by Mycobacterium leprae. It primarily affects the skin, peripheral nerves, mucous membranes, and eyes, leading to disfigurement and disability if left untreated. The flagella stain procedure is a specialized staining technique used in microbiology to visualize bacterial flagella under a microscope. The D-value (decimal reduction time) in microbiology indicates the time needed to reduce a microbial population by 90%. This signifies a 1 log reduction under specific conditions. These conditions include a particular temperature or a particular disinfectant. It is a measure of a microorganism’s resistance to a sterilization or disinfection process. Growing beneficial bacteria for ponds is a great way to improve water quality, control algae, and support aquatic life. These bacteria help break down organic waste, convert harmful ammonia into less toxic substances, and maintain a balanced ecosystem. Anaerobic bacteria are microorganisms that grow in oxygen-free environments and play significant roles in human health and disease. In clinical settings, they are commonly associated with infections such as abscesses, soft tissue infections, and post-surgical complications. The API test (Analytical Profile Index) in microbiology , is a biochemical panel-based testing system used to identify microorganisms, primarily bacteria and yeast, by determining their metabolic and enzymatic activities.
